Local and global analyticity for \(\mu\)-Camassa-Holm equations
Abstract: We solve Cauchy problems for some -Camassa-Holm integro-partial differential equations in the analytic category. The equations to be considered are CH of Khesin-Lenells-Misiol{}ek, DP of Lenells-Misiol{}ek-Tiu{g}lay, the higher-order CH of Wang-Li-Qiao and the non-quasilinear version of Qu-Fu-Liu. We prove the unique local solvability of the Cauchy problems and provide an estimate of the lifespan of the solutions. Moreover, we show the existence of a unique global-in-time analytic solution for CH, DP and the higher-order CH. The present work is the first result of such a global nature for these equations.
